Preparation. Blend tomatoes thoroughly in food processor or electric blender. Heat oil in sauce pan and add garlic and peppers. Cook, stirring occasionally, about 3 minutes. Do not brown. Add tomatoes, oregano, salt and pepper. Simmer, uncovered, about seven minutes.


Crockpot Sausage and Peppers Slow Cooker Foodie

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Saute onion in oil until translucent, 5 to 7 minutes. Stir sausage with the onion. Pour tomato sauce over the sausage mixture; bring to a simmer and cook for 20 minutes. Stir bell pepper into the mixture to coat in tomato sauce; cook until the bell pepper is tender, about 20 minutes more.

Sheet Pan Method. Slice the sausage into rounds. Slice the peppers and onions. Mince the garlic. Toss the ingredients with 1 tablespoon of oil and bake at 400 degrees F for 40 minutes until browned, stirring halfway through. Put into a bowl and add warmed Marinara sauce. Divide and serve.
